SPYG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

419 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R Portfolio S&P 500 Growth ETF (SPYG)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$4B — up 27% from $3.14B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 66 funds opened new SPYG positions and 56 closed out — a net gain of 10 holders — while 163 added to existing stakes and 147 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Envestnet Asset Management, adding an estimated $423M. The largest seller was AlphaStar Capital Management, cutting an estimated $37.7M.
